Top 5 Short Haircuts to Rejuvenate Women Over 50 in the US

Short hairstyles remain popular among American women over 50 because they create lift and reduce bulk around the neckline. Some offer texture and volume, which help the face appear younger and brighter.

1. Angled Bob

Haircut for women over 50 years old - Angled Bob

Source: Pinterest

This timeless haircut is shorter in the back and slightly longer in the front, creating a structured and elegant look. It adds energy to facial features and brings a modern touch.

The angled bob is ideal for women over 50 as it defines facial contours and adds volume to thinning hair. It also provides a sophisticated and youthful appearance.

2. Layered Short Bob

Haircut for women over 50 years old - Short Layered Bob

Source: Pinterest

Also known as the layered short bob, this timeless and sophisticated hairstyle reaches just above or at the ears. It features soft layers that add volume and movement.

This cut is perfect for women over 50 because it gives a rejuvenating effect and suits all hair textures. Celebrities like Evelyne Dhéliat and Sophie Davant have embraced this style.

3. Wavy Bob

Haircut for women over 50 years old - Wavy bob

Source: Pinterest

This softly wavy bob creates a casual and airy look. It brings natural volume and a light structure to the hair.

Waves help soften facial features and provide a more youthful appearance. This cut is perfect for women looking for a relaxed, fresh, and modern hairstyle.

4. Pixie Cut

Haircut for women over 50 years old - Pixie cut

Source: Pinterest

The pixie cut is a very short haircut with feathered strands that frame the face. It can be styled sleek or tousled for a trendier look.

It highlights facial features and brightens the eyes. It's perfect for women with fine hair because it adds volume with little effort. This cut conveys both modernity and confidence.

5. Boyish Cut

Haircut for women over 50 - Boyish Cut

Source: Pinterest

The boyish cut is ultra-modern and full of character. It’s heavily layered, exposing the neck and emphasizing features like the eyes and cheekbones.

This haircut is ideal for bold women looking for a dynamic, youthful, and confident style. It adds an assertive yet feminine flair, especially when styled with volume or a soft side-swept bang.

Top 5 Long Haircuts to Rejuvenate Women Over 50 in the US

Longer hairstyles for mature women in the US focus on movement and blended layers. Soft waves, face-framing layers, collarbone-length cuts, and long blended bobs help create softness around the jawline and keep hair looking healthy and lifted.

1. The Lob

Haircut for women over 50 years old - Lob

Source: Pinterest

The lob is a longer version of the bob, usually falling around the shoulders. It can be slightly layered for extra movement and lightness.

It’s a versatile cut that softens facial features and suits all face shapes. The lob gives a modern and chic touch without requiring much styling—ideal for women seeking a youthful, polished look.

2. Layered Mid-Length

Haircut for women over 50 years old - Layered Mid-Length Hair

Source: Pinterest

This mid-length cut with soft layers adds volume and movement, perfect for fine or aging hair.

As hair naturally thins with age, a layered style brings back body and bounce. It flatters the face and offers a light, rejuvenating effect.

3. Curtain Bangs

Haircut for women over 50 years old - Curtain Bangs

Source: Pinterest

Curtain bangs part softly down the middle, framing the face on both sides for a relaxed, natural effect.

This fringe helps hide forehead wrinkles and soften features without hardening the face, offering a trendy and elegant touch that suits all lengths and styles.

3 Haircuts to Avoid for Women Over 50

Some haircuts can actually make you look older rather than younger. Here are three styles to avoid:

  1. Long Hair Without Layers
  2. Sleek, Ultra-Straight Bob
  3. Bowl Cut

1. Long Hair Without Layers

Very long, non-layered hair can weigh down facial features and make hair look thinner. As hair naturally loses volume with age, an overly long style can emphasize this effect.


2. Sleek, Ultra-Straight Bob

A perfectly straight, blunt bob can create a severe look that accentuates wrinkles and sharp facial lines. A softer, wavy, or layered version is more flattering.


3. Bowl Cut

This rounded, very short haircut can lack modernity and create an aging effect. If you prefer short hair, opt for a textured pixie cut instead for a more dynamic and youthful look.
